Account recovery for the Larkstone kiosk watchdog: if the watchdog locks out the service account after three failed restarts, reboot the kiosk into maintenance mode and open the recovery console. The console prompts for account confirmation before restoring the watchdog profile. Enter the recovery passphrase shown below.

strongbox words: fraath-isteth

## Transporting the locked test-device case

Records folks: the grey locked case holding the Tindale test devices moves between the Carrow Street archive and the bench lab only via the scheduled courier run — never in personal cars, please. The case stays locked end to end; keys never travel with it. Log the movement in the transport register with seal number and time out. One last thing: the courier hand-over instruction sits right below this paragraph.

courier memo of yahif-faweg: the quenael tamius courier leaves the prawyn jorix kaswyn istox silmir brieth zormir fenvan ledger at gate 3145 under passcode 231062

## Report exports: timezones

All exports from Ferrowline render timestamps in the workspace's configured zone, not UTC, and the release pipeline stamps each export bundle accordingly. Release managers should verify the bundle signature before promoting a build to the export fleet. The key used to sign export bundles is shown here.

deploy key for hawef-yadup: bky19_kVT4YunTZZSTyhFQQoK

- [ ] Verify the Larkspur catalogue import signing key was generated inside the Brightmoor HSM before the MARC batch from the Fennelwick Library consortium is ingested. Two witnesses must confirm the key never left the ceremony room, and the import checksum must match the ledger entry. Once both signatures are recorded, unseal the escrow envelope containing the phrase below.

vault phrase of yagag-kadup = belael-druius-rusax-kelox